Funkcja zaokrąglająca "krokowo"

Przedstawiam prostą funkcję, która zaokrągla liczbę do wartości najbliższego kroku:

roundStep<-function(x, step, start=0){
	if(missing(x)|missing(step))
		stop("Missing argument")
	return(round((x-start)/step)*step+start)
}

Created by Pretty R at inside-R.org

admin środa, 28 grudzień 2011 - 12:08 pm | | Blog-R